Electrolysis is a way of removing individual hairs from the face or body. Today's medical electrolysis devices, called epilators, destroy the growth center of the hair with a short-wave radio frequency. This is done by inserting a very fine probe into the hair follicle at the surface of the skin. The hair is then removed harmlessly with forceps.

Lead can be used as an anode in electrolysis, but it may not be the most optimal choice due to its tendency to corrode and form lead oxide during the electrolysis process. This can affect the efficiency and longevity of the anode. Using materials like platinum or graphite for the anode may be more suitable for certain electrolysis applications.

Electrolysis (coming from "electro", meaning electricity, and "lysis", meaning to cut) is the process whereby electricity is used to break apart a substance into two different substances. For example, electrolysis of water produces its constituent elemental gases, hydrogen and oxygen by this process: 2H20 + (electricity) --> 2H2 + O2
